Packaging label for omeprazole delayed release tablets 20 mg by Publix Super Markets Inc. The label indicates 42 wildberry mint coated tablets designed for acid reduction and frequent heartburn treatment. It features dosage instructions, safety warnings, and a comparison reference to Prilosec OTC®.*

Drug Facts panel for omeprazole 20 mg delayed-release oral tablets by Publix Super Markets Inc. Includes active ingredient, uses, warnings about allergies and symptoms, directions for adults 18 and older, 14-day treatment course details, repeated courses instructions, inactive ingredients list, storage information, and contact details for the distributor.*
